
02.12.2015For processing of low-grade iron ores, ground to finer size necessitates the use of centrifugal force. This is because the settling rate of the particles in centrifugal force is 500–600 times more than that noticed for the nominal gravitational force. 13.09.2021Typically, iron ore fines from the region will display moisture contents of between 13% and 16% during the wet season. In addition, it is normal for the upper surfaces of any stockpiled material to appear relatively dry during the dry season period but wet at increasing depths throughout the stockpiled material.

12.05.2021The price difference between high-grade 65% iron ore and 58% ore surged to a record $90.5 per tonne, while between benchmark 62% ore and low-grade the spread stood at $57.5.

09-08-2022DRI-electric arc furnace (EAF) technology is proven and in use today. However, it requires high-quality iron ore (DR-grade) with iron (Fe) content of 67% and above, which has lower levels of impurities. 26.06.2012however, for classification and evaluation of quality, the raw iron ores can be divided into three basic classes depending on the total fe content: (i) high-grade iron ores with a total fe content above 65%, (ii) medium- or average-grade ores with varied fe contents in the range between 62–64%, and (iii) low-grade ores with fe contents below 58%

09.08.2022Apart from the DRI-Melter-BOF routes, various companies are developing fluidised bed reduction processes that can reduce iron ore using hydrogen rather than via fossil fuels. An advantage of such processes is their ability to use iron ore fines, eliminating the cost and energy used in iron ore pelletisation or agglomeration.

10-10-2018The generation of iron ore slimes in India is estimated to be 10-15% by weight of the total ore mined. The iron ore values are lost to the tune of 10-15 million tonnes per year.

02-03-2022Lower metallurgical coke prices have encouraged some Chinese steel mills to increase use of lower-grade iron ore, though rising mill margins have kept demand firm for higher grades. China's metallurgical coke prices fell last week as domestic coke producers accepted a 100 yuan/t ($15.50/t) purchase price drop amid rising inventories.

18.08.2015At optimum conditions (iron ore fines was first preheated at 400 C and then mixed with tar according to tar/iron ore fines 0.6, reacted at 900 C for 30 min under the steam atmosphere with the mass ratio of steam/tar 0.87), the reduced iron product with metallization rate 94.1% was achieved.
